How they compare
Albania currently reports 0.1943 against 0.1942 in Ukraine, a difference of 0.0001.
The two have swapped places 7 times across 41 shared years of data; in 1980 it was Ukraine ahead.
Albania ranks 116th and Ukraine ranks 117th of 183 countries.
Across the 5 decades both report, Albania averaged higher in 2 and Ukraine in 2.

About this data
The dataset contains nine indices that summarize how developed financial institutions and financial markets are in terms of their depth, access, and efficiency. These indices are aggregated into an overall index of financial development. With the coverage of over 180 countries on annual frequency from 1980 onwards, the database should offer a useful analytical tool for researchers and policy makers.
